The Dragon was an absolute blast!!! The weather was gorgeous. The scenery was spectacular. And the road was perfect to say the least.
Before going up there, I was extremely paranoid b/c of what everyone was saying. "don't ever, ever, ever, EVAH cross the center line!" So, I started off pretty slow. But around mile 3 or 4 I got bored and decided to go balls to the wall! Not too extreme, but enough to see how my car reacted to the twist and turns of the road. It also shows you what needs to be upgraded or replaced on your car. For instance, my brakes started fading half way through which forced me to slow down. As far as drifting is concerned....i won't recommend it. There are way too many blind corners and motorcycles up there. However, on particular (wide-open) corners, I kicked it out a couple of times; just some power-overs..nothing special.
Overall it was an awesome experience that I highly recommend to all of you. But like Charlie said.....it not a playground; your FOERST wrong move will be your(or your car's) last. The Dragon is very unforgiving. So, if you go be very alert and very prepared for anything.
